"Queens" is co-extensive with Queens county
Originally, Queens County included the area now comprising Nassau County.
From 1683 until 1784, Queens County consisted of these towns:
Flushing, Hempstead, Jamaica, Newtown, Oyster Bay
The town of North Hempstead was added in 1784
City of Long Island City - 1870
All of Flushing, Jamaica, Long Island City, and Newtown, as well as the Rockaway Peninsula portion of Hempstead
were consolidated into Greater New York in 1898. The rest of Hempstead and the Towns of North Hempstead and Oyster
Bay split from Queens County to form Nassau County in 1899.
County Seat: New York City
Year Organized: 1683 as one of the 12 original counties
Square Miles: 309
Queens Borough was established on Jan 1, 1898
